Southwest adds cockpit safety alerts across fleet of 800 planes

0 Comments

Southwest Airlines on Monday said it has added cockpit safety alerts to nearly its entire fleet of 800 aircraft. The safety alert system, designed by Honeywell, sets off verbal and text warnings if a pilot is about to use the wrong runway or approaches too fast for landing.
